Food pantry available for families in need


By Daniel Arens

Although COVID-19 has changed many things, the Hazen Food Pantry remains a place where those struggling to make ends meet can find support and needed supplies.
Food pantry volunteers Lindy Suelzle and Theresa Moore said the number of people coming to the pantry dropped after the virus really started impacting things in the state, although it has picked up again somewhat since then. Whether people are afraid of coming to the pantry’s location at English Lutheran Church or are just uncertain about what the status of the pantry is during the pandemic, the result was a decrease in activity, if not in need.
